    Default How to not let keyclone to broadcast my password?

    How do I not let keyclone to broadcast my password when I am logging in to WOW using maximizer?

    I notice that when I type the password on one account password, the same password is shown on the other account.

    Will there be any compromise to the password being exposed. Any tips or advice will be appreciated.

    Thank you.

  2. #2

    Default

    you can hit the pause key while loging in. or make all your passwords the same and just log them all in at the same time.

    the PAUSE key is the default hotkey for override. check keyclone/setup/override settings for more settings.

    it is also useful when you want to chat and not have all your clones talking at the same time.
